15th overall wrote:Was just looking over the rules/scoring--- I've never been in a league with specific defensive positions (DB/DL) before... how highly are they valued? Like do they produce similar to kickers? or maybe iffy WRs? Is a stud DL who racks up sack totals gonna be on par with an average RB? When can I expect the first one to be drafted? Are there player rankings (Berry, Eisenberg, etc) with defensive players included or are we just kinda on our own there?

Really any tips/warnings will help. My long time league is PPR and with strictly D/ST and K. I've done classic scoring a while back, but again, with the D/ST setup.


Similiar to kickers and DST. If you want JJ Watt you will have to take him early but you can probably just cobble it together. Yahoo has rankings but they suck. You if you search the internet you can find some better rankings.
